I've got a can of the Moly Spray. Not sure if it's the same stuff as mentioned.

It's Dow Corning 321 Dry Film Lube. Spray it on, & let it dry. Leaves a nice grey coat of Moly. Works pretty good too! I snagged a can from work. We use it to lube up Compactor Ram Guide Rails. Doesn't attract dirt like oil or grease. GREAT stuff, but smells like Donkey's butt!
